This Mexican Restaurant is located in Montelago Village, a new development community in the Las Vegas Lake area. The menu is very basic with the standard Mexican American fare but it is authentic and good.
Upon seating we are served a basket of hot tortilla chips and salsa. I'm not a fan of the multi coloured red, green and natural chips but the salsa is tasty. They use green onions instead of ted onions.
For our mains, I ordered the pork enchiladas with green sauce, re-fried beans and rice. It was the perfect amount and well done. The cheese topping was ok. A word of caution, they are served really really hot! So wait a few minutes before taking a bite!I prefer plain melted cheese.
Husby had chicken tacos which were ok, the chicken was a bit dry and I'm not a fan of the lightly crisped up taco shells, I like corn tortillas warm and soft.
Service was excellent, as soon as your fork goes down, they swoop in and cleanup!
